The formula for a circumference is 2 times Pi times Radius. A diameter is twice the Radius, so the circumference is Diameter times Pi.
5 times Pi (3.14159) is approximately 15.70795.
Pi has an endless number of digits to the right of the decimal point, so the best we can do is approximate.
